4 yearsGot a call from someone claiming to be Alison at the bank, talking about a letter sent out last week. She said it wasn’t urgent and promised to call back next week. The number was pretty similar to my branch’s landline, so I decided to check with the bank directly (not the number that called me). They told me to block the caller straight away, saying it was very likely a scam.AlisonSubmit Your Own Report (0141 532 9235)

About 01 Numbers
These numbers refer to specific locations in the UK and are widely used by homes and businesses. Also known as as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the call costs for these geographic numbers are contingent on the time of day. A good number of service providers offer call packages that include free calls during selected times. Call costs from mobile phones are according to the chosen calling plan, with a lot of plans containing these numbers in their free call packages.
